Output 332db3d8c635a39bcadd98e434edccdf890cdaf02d263a85fabcfad6013c5237:16

value
22590249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ea5e6d69d686c96e2f1791ebabd8eecdeb8e03e OP_EQUAL
address
MVf1o91SZp6CVVbutNT1Ya5FQKZa3xtRwA
transaction
332db3d8c635a39bcadd98e434edccdf890cdaf02d263a85fabcfad6013c5237
spent
true